Dry Well Construction in Birmingham, AL
Dry well construction services involve creating underground drainage systems designed to manage excess surface and groundwater runoff. These systems typically consist of a gravel-filled excavation with an outlet pipe that directs water away from foundations, basements, and other structures to prevent flooding and water damage. Property owners often request dry well installation for projects such as yard drainage improvements, managing runoff from driveways or patios, or addressing drainage issues caused by heavy rainfall. Before requesting this service, it’s helpful for homeowners to understand the property’s drainage needs, the location of existing underground utilities, and the soil conditions that could affect the effectiveness of a dry well.
Proper planning ensures the dry well functions effectively and complies with local regulations. Property owners usually want to know the appropriate size and capacity of the dry well for their specific drainage requirements, as well as the best placement to ensure proper water flow. Additionally, understanding the maintenance needs and potential impact on landscaping can help in making informed decisions. Contacting a professional for an assessment can provide clarity on the suitability of a dry well system for the property’s unique conditions and drainage goals.

Dry Well Construction Questions
What is a dry well? A dry well is an underground structure that helps manage excess water by directing it away from foundations and landscaping.
When is a dry well needed? A dry well is useful when there is poor drainage, frequent pooling, or to prevent water damage around a property.
What materials are used for dry well construction? Common materials include gravel, perforated pipe, and concrete or plastic chambers designed for drainage.
How does a dry well improve property drainage? It collects and disperses water underground, reducing surface runoff and preventing erosion or flooding.
